William Everett is Professor of Musicology and Associate Dean for Graduate Studies and Curriculum at the University of Missouri-Kansas City Conservatory of Music and Dance. He is the author of Sigmund Romberg (Yale UP, 2007), Rudolf Friml (Illinois, 2008), contributing co-editor of The Cambridge Companion to the Musical (2002; 2nd ed., 2008), and a contributing editor for musical theater for the Grove Dictionary of American Music, 2nd ed. His research specialties include American musical theater, particularly operettas of the early twentieth century, and the relationship between music and national identity.

Everett was reviews editor for College Music Symposium from 2000 to 2006, and is currently a member of the editorial board for Studies in Musical Theatre and the editorial advisory board for Palgrave Studies in British Musical Theatre. He served as Program Chair for CMS’s 2009 International Conference in Croatia and was the Society’s national vice-president from 2011 to 2013. He currently chairs CMS’s International Initiatives Committee.
